It's a mandatory test for gestational diabetes around 24-28 weeks. Take a book or your laptop with you because you have to wait at the lab for a couple of hours for multiple blood draws.
It is a simple blood test to check for gestational diabetes. They make you drink a glucose solution and test your blood after an hour or two, please don't be anxious about it.
